| dc.description.abstract | Water is an essential element in the life of the human being for which its conservation and good use is necessary, in this work we make a proposal for the development of a low-cost system for water management in order to save on Its consumption, using infrared technology, the results provide a mechanism that can be replicated and at different scales, by the use of commonly used devices. © 2022 Elsevier B.V., All rights reserved. | |
